Why 1917 Matters:

The year 1917 witnessed two major revolutions in Russia: the February Revolution, which overthrew the Tsarist autocracy, and the October Revolution, which established the Bolshevik regime. These events profoundly impacted global affairs, leading to the withdrawal of Russia from World War I, the rise of communism as a significant political ideology, and a cascade of political changes across Europe and beyond. Therefore, any ruler who held power until 1917 likely did so before these watershed moments. Understanding this historical context is crucial to solving the crossword clue effectively.

Tsar Nicholas II of Russia (1894-1917):

Nicholas II was the last Emperor of Russia, reigning from 1894 until his abdication in 1917. His rule was marked by increasing political instability, social unrest, and economic hardship. His autocratic style of governance alienated many, fueling discontent amongst the peasantry, the working class, and even segments of the aristocracy. His involvement in World War I further exacerbated these issues, leading to widespread food shortages, economic collapse, and ultimately, the February Revolution. While he initially attempted to suppress the revolution, the tide turned swiftly, and he was forced to abdicate in March 1917. He and his family were later executed by the Bolsheviks in 1918. Therefore, Nicholas II perfectly fits the clue "Ruler Until 1917" in terms of both timeline and historical significance.
